Blockly example:
move circle position 1 to position 2: From current position, the whole circle is
determined by current position and position1
and positon2, “center angle” specifies how
much of the circle to execute.
Note: (1) The starting point, pose 1 and pose 2 determine the three reference points of a complete circle. If the
motion path of the robotic arm is a circular arc, then pose 1 and pose 2 are not necessarily end points or passing
points;
(2) If you want the robot arm to change its posture during the movement, set the roll, pitch, and yaw of pose 2 to
the desired posture when completing the trajectory;
center angle (°) () : Indicates the degree of the circle. When it is set to 360, a
whole circle can be completed, and it can be greater than or
less than 360;
Note: To achieve smooth motion, you need to set Wait = false.
Example explanation:
In this example, the central angle is set to 3600°, which means that the robotic arm
can draw ten circles at a time, and the robotic arm still stays at the starting point after
drawing a circle.
Judgment of the direction of the robotic arm motion
In the above example, the starting point, pose 1 and pose 2 are:
A (300,0,400,180,0,0) B (350,50,400,180,0,0) C (350,-50,400,180,0,0)
